Skip to content

Extension d'image

POST
/kling/v1/images/editing/expand

Étend proportionnellement la toile autour d'une image de référence et génère le résultat d'outpainting.

Authorizations

bearer
Type
HTTP (bearer)

Request Body

application/json
object

Image de référence.
Prend en charge le Base64 ou une URL d'image (doit être accessible).

Zone d'extension vers le haut, calculée comme multiple de la hauteur de l'image d'origine.
Plage : [0, 2]. La surface totale de la nouvelle image ne doit pas dépasser 3× l'originale.
Exemple : hauteur 20, valeur 0,1 → distance du bord supérieur d'origine au nouveau = 20 × 0,1 = 2 (zone d'extension).

Zone d'extension vers le bas, calculée comme multiple de la hauteur de l'image d'origine.
Plage : [0, 2]. La surface totale de la nouvelle image ne doit pas dépasser 3× l'originale.
Exemple : hauteur 20, valeur 0,2 → distance du bord inférieur d'origine au nouveau = 20 × 0,2 = 4 (zone d'extension).

Zone d'extension vers la gauche, calculée comme multiple de la largeur de l'image d'origine.
Plage : [0, 2]. La surface totale de la nouvelle image ne doit pas dépasser 3× l'originale.
Exemple : largeur 30, valeur 0,3 → distance du bord gauche d'origine au nouveau = 30 × 0,3 = 9 (zone d'extension).

Zone d'extension vers la droite, calculée comme multiple de la largeur de l'image d'origine.
Plage : [0, 2]. La surface totale de la nouvelle image ne doit pas dépasser 3× l'originale.
Exemple : largeur 30, valeur 0,4 → distance du bord droit d'origine au nouveau = 30 × 0,4 = 12 (zone d'extension).

Invite textuelle positive.
Jusqu'à 2500 caractères.

Nombre d'images à générer.
Plage : [1, 9].

URL de rappel à la fin de la tâche

ID de tâche externe

Responses

OK

application/json
object

ID de tâche

Statut de la tâche

Playground

Authorization
Body

Samples